Circuit/System Description The K219 Lighting Control Module receives serial data messages from the K9 Body Control Module (BCM) indicating what lamps have been activated on the vehicle. The lighting control module responds by applying voltage to the appropriate relay control circuit(s). With the relay coil energized, the relay contacts close and allow voltage to flow through the relay illuminating the appropriate lamps on the attached trailer. For stop lamp operation, the lighting control module will control the both trailer stop/turn signal lamp relays ON anytime the stop lamp are commanded ON. For turn signal lamp operation, the lighting control module will control the appropriate trailer stop/turn signal lamp relay in an ON/OFF duty cycle when the turn signal lamps are commanded ON. Diagnostic Aids Trailer lighting is controlled through non-serviceable printed circuit board (PCB) relays. A defective relay will require complete fuse block replacement. Conditions for Running the DTC Battery voltage must be between 9–16 V. Stop lamps or turn signal lamps ON. Conditions for Setting the DTC DTC B10A9 11 The K219 lighting control module detects a short to ground on control circuit 318. DTC B10A9 12 The K219 lighting control module detects a short to voltage on control circuit 318. DTC B10A9 13 The K219 lighting control module detects an open/high resistance on control circuit 318. DTC B1BB5 11 The K219 lighting control module detects a short to ground on control circuit 319. DTC B1BB5 12 The K219 lighting control module detects a short to voltage on control circuit 319. DTC B1BB5 13 The K219 lighting control module detects an open/high resistance on control circuit 319. Actions Taken When the DTC Sets The appropriate trailer stop/turn signal lamps will be inoperative. Conditions for Clearing the DTC The condition responsible for setting the DTC no longer exists. A history DTC will clear once 50 consecutive malfunction-free ignition cycles have occurred. - Connect a test lamp between the appropriate trailer fuse and ground, ignition ON/vehicle in service mode: DTC B10A9 = Fuse F73UA DTC B1BB5 = Fuse F81UA
- Verify the test lamp turns ON and OFF when commanding the appropriate trailer lamp ON and OFF with a scan tool: Left Trailer Turn Signal/Stop Lamp Command Right Trailer Turn Signal/Stop Lamp Command ⇒ If the test lamp does not turn ON and OFF Refer to Circuit/System Testing ⇓ If the test lamp turns ON and OFF
- A fault is not currently present and may be an intermittent condition. Circuit/System Testing
- Ignition ON/vehicle in service mode, exterior lamps OFF.
- Connect a test lamp between the appropriate trailer fuse and ground: DTC B10A9 = Fuse F73UA DTC B1BB5 = Fuse F81UA
- Verify the test lamp turns ON and OFF when commanding the appropriate trailer lamp ON and OFF with a scan tool: DTC B10A9 = Left Trailer Turn Signal/Stop Lamp Command DTC B1BB5 = Right Trailer Turn Signal/Stop Lamp Command ⇒ If the test lamp is always OFF 3.1. Test the ground circuit at the X50A Engine Wiring Harness Junction Block for an open/high resistance. ⇒ If an open/high resistance is found, repair the fault on the circuit or ground connection. ⇓ If an open/high resistance is not found. 3.2. Test the appropriate control circuit for a short to ground: DTC B10A9 = Circuit 318 DTC B1BB5 = Circuit 319 ⇒ If a short to ground is found, repair the fault on the circuit. ⇓ If a short to ground is not found. 3.3. Test the appropriate control circuit for an open/high resistance: DTC B10A9 = Circuit 318 DTC B1BB5 = Circuit 319 ⇒ If an open/high resistance is found, repair the fault on the circuit. ⇓ If an open/high resistance is not found. 3.4. Replace the X50A Engine Wiring Harness Junction Block. ⇒ If the test lamp is always ON 3.1. Test the appropriate control circuit for a short to voltage: DTC B10A9 = Circuit 318 DTC B1BB5 = Circuit 319 ⇒ If a short to voltage is found, repair the fault on the circuit. ⇓ If a short to voltage is not found. 3.2. Replace the X50A Engine Wiring Harness Junction Block. ⇓ If the test lamp turns ON and OFF
- Replace the K219 Lighting Control Module. Repair Instructions Perform the Diagnostic Repair Verification after completing the repair. Control Module References for trailer lamp control module replacement, programming, and setup
